The rumors have been flying for quite some time now and it appears they're about to become a reality:
Jeep has just announced that a diesel-powered version of its Grand Cherokee will premiere at the Detroit Auto Show next month. The news comes courtesy of Ward's Auto, who reports that Jeep President and CEO Mike Manley stated of the upcoming reveal that "If the emails and the letters I've gotten from Jeep customers are anything to go by, it will be very, very good."
